Description:
This Program encourages research in social science in order to obtain information that will enable more efficient doping prevention strategies.
WADA’s mission is to promote, co-ordinate and monitor, on an international basis, the fight against doping in sport in all its forms. As part of its strategic objectives, WADA has identified both education and research as priorities. It is essential that anti-doping education programs and initiatives be based on scientific knowledge and evidence.
